FaxOpenPort

関数
指定したFAXデバイスのポートを開く。
DLLWINFAX.dll呼出規約winapi

シグネチャ

// WINFAX.dll
#include <windows.h>

BOOL FaxOpenPort(
    HANDLE FaxHandle,
    DWORD DeviceId,
    DWORD Flags,
    HANDLE* FaxPortHandle
);

パラメーター

名前方向説明
FaxHandleHANDLEinFAXサーバー接続のハンドルを指定する。
DeviceIdDWORDin開く対象のFAXデバイス(ポート)の識別子を指定する。
FlagsDWORDinポートのアクセス方法を指定するフラグ。PORT_OPEN_QUERYやPORT_OPEN_MODIFY等を組み合わせる。
FaxPortHandleHANDLE*out開かれたFAXポートのハンドルを受け取るポインタを指定する。出力専用。

戻り値の型: BOOL
